Engraphis
Engraphis is a local-first memory engine built so AI coding agents keep useful project context across sessions and repositories using SQLite and hybrid recall.

Founding Story
Engraphis was started to solve the problem of AI coding agents starting from zero every session and losing context, while avoiding the privacy risks of hosted memory services.
Business Model
Revenue Model
Subscription SaaS for Pro and Team tiers; core local engine is free and open-source.
Pricing Tiers
Local engine, MCP server, dashboard, CLI, and library under Apache-2.0.
Everything in Community plus analytics, auto-consolidation, and optional hosted Cloud Sync.
Everything in Pro plus multi-user roles, seat management, and shared cloud sync.
